A slender cursive script with a consistent rightward slant and airy, calligraphic strokes. Letterforms are built from smooth, continuous curves with frequent entry/exit strokes and occasional long, tapering terminals that create gentle swashes. Uppercase characters are more ornamental, featuring extended loops and open counters, while the lowercase maintains a delicate rhythm with compact bodies and pronounced ascenders/descenders. The numerals follow the same flowing construction, reading as handwritten forms with curved spines and light finishing flicks.

Best suited to short-to-medium display settings where its flourishes can breathe—wedding stationery, invitations, greeting cards, boutique branding, labels, and pull quotes. It also works well for signature-style marks or accent text when paired with a simple serif or sans.

The overall tone feels graceful and intimate, like a neat signature or formal note written with a steady hand. Its looping capitals and soft, sweeping connections lend a romantic, old-world elegance without becoming overly rigid or geometric.

The design appears aimed at capturing the look of practiced handwritten cursive with a polished, decorative finish. Its emphasis on expressive capitals, flowing joins, and tapered terminals suggests an intention to provide an elegant script for personal, celebratory, and premium-facing typography.

Spacing appears naturally handwritten, with slightly irregular widths and lively stroke endings that add movement across a line. The very small lowercase bodies relative to the ascenders/descenders emphasize a tall, airy silhouette, and the more elaborate capitals stand out strongly in titles and initials.
